[QUOTE="moneyseemoneydo, post: 1065424, member: 25360"]The way that seems work fine for me is using a small pocket knife on a 'reverse' corner- you'll notice a slightly larger gap between the black and the clear plastics on at least one on the 4 corners. Starting there and carefully prying up the clear using the black as leverage and working your way around or sometimes moving to the next corner if it gets stuborn- you'll have it open in no time.[/QUOTE]
